Foundation Elements
The words that go into your Foundations need to reflect solid, almost non-negotiable, elements. These are the elements that if you aren't doing them on a daily basis will mean that your Collaboration, Connection, Communication and Resilience will be impacted. It means that your Vision isn't being achieved as easily nor your Primary Task. They can be actions, attitudes, behaviours - whatever you think needs to be part of the Foundations of the RDT.
When you consider your words, look at the Pillars, Vision and Primary Task. Do your checks and balances and look for line of sight from the Foundation through to Primary Task.
All of the Pillars will not be validated when you are doing this activity; but you will be seeing the themes and intent coming through from your discussions and what has been shared - in the workshops sessions and your small group work, as well as what's been shared online here.
